Taxation FAQs
- Do I need to complete a Self Assessment tax return?
-
You are usually required to complete a Self Assessment return if you are self-employed, a company director, a higher or additional rate taxpayer, or if you receive income from property, savings, or investments. - Does my business need to register for VAT?
-
You are legally required to register for VAT once your taxable turnover exceeds the current registration threshold of £90,000 in any rolling 12-month period. It may also be worth registering voluntarily below that threshold, particularly if your customers are VAT-registered businesses themselves. - What are Research and Development tax credits?
-
R&D tax credits are a valuable government incentive designed to reward businesses that invest in innovation. If your company is developing new products, processes, or services, or making meaningful improvements to existing ones, you may be able to claim a significant reduction in your Corporation Tax liability, or in some cases receive a cash credit. - What is Creative Industry Tax Relief?
-
Creative Industry Tax Relief covers a range of sector-specific reliefs available to qualifying businesses in film, television, animation, video games, and other creative sectors. If your business is producing or developing creative content, you may be able to claim an enhanced deduction on qualifying expenditure. - What happens if HMRC selects me for a Self Assessment enquiry?
-
HMRC has the right to open an enquiry into any tax return, and being selected does not necessarily mean there is anything wrong.
